This set of six authentic Saarinen Tulip chairs represents early Knoll production, manufactured during the most sought-after period of the design’s history. Produced under the Knoll Associates name, these chairs date to the late 1950s–early 1960s, when designer Eero Saarinen’s vision of a single, sculptural pedestal form was still revolutionary—and when quality, materiality, and hand-finishing were paramount.
The chairs retain their original fiberglass shells, cast aluminum pedestal bases, and original vinyl seat pads, offering an increasingly rare opportunity to acquire an untouched set that has not been refinished, repainted, or reupholstered. For collectors and purists, this originality is precisely what gives the set its character, integrity, and long-term value.
The fiberglass shells display the subtle translucency and texture associated with early production examples, while the bases show period casting and stamping consistent with Knoll manufacture of the era. The original vinyl upholstery exhibits age-related cracking and wear, and the bases show visible chips along the edges—evidence of decades of honest use rather than later restoration. These details speak to authenticity and allow the chairs to present as true archival pieces rather than modern recreations.
